ANNUAL CLUB DINNER – FRIDAY 16th MAY ‘08


Combe Down Rugby club are proud to announce, their guest speaker at the 2008 Annual Club Dinnerwill be

Mr Nigel Redman (Ollie) of Bath, England and British Lions.


Tickets will be on sale at CDRFC £25.00 (members), £30.00 (non members).

Dress Code: CDRFC Tie, Jacket, Trousers (no jeans).


NIGEL CHARLES REDMAN (Ollie)


Lock. 6’4” 17st 2lb Born 16/8/1964 in Cardiff.


Rugby Pedigree:- Weston R.F.C. (at age 15), England Colts, England Under 23 (Captain), and South West Division. In 1984 he was selected as England lock against Australia when he was 20 years old. He went on to win 20 England caps and was in England’s World Cup squads in 1987 and 1991.


Nigel played on the British Lions Tour 1997 and proudly captained the Lions midweek side against Northern Free State winning 52-30.


Nigel Redman’s first outing was something of a baptism of fire against Welsh international Allan Martin. As always – ‘Ollie’ performed with distinction. His final Bath appearance was 7/3/1999 v Newcastle after 349 games, 34 tries and 146 points.


Nigel is a senior R.F.U. National Academy Coach. Also, he is well known to TV viewers as an ‘eagle-eyed’ match analysis expert and glad to help out with Bath Minis on Sunday mornings.
